Hi. This is Hong Kong here.

If you do not care about paying a fraction more , go to any Broadway
shop( There is a big one in Cityplaza, Taikoo Shing). Definitely
genuine product from dealer, but you have to contribute to the shop
rent and the 30 odd year reputation.

But obviously the HK warranty is no use to you anyway, so why not
visit a shop like Coxell(www.cam2.com.hk ). They well both dealer and
parallel import at much cheaper price. They have 2 shops in and near
Wanchai computer city. There are quite a few camera shop in the
computer city as well.
